Capacity note for the Bramblewick export retry queue. Failed exports are requeued with exponential backoff, and the queue depth is our main capacity signal: sustained depth above the high-water mark means downstream Pellis storage is saturated, not that we need more workers. As the new contractor, please don't raise worker counts without checking storage latency first — it usually makes things worse. Retry timing, backoff caps, and the high-water threshold are all driven by the constants shown below.

limits module of yagef-bajog:
TIERS = {
    "druael": 370,
    "tamix": 286,
    "pelius": 541,
    "pelael": 78,
    "pelox": 47,
    "ralath": 533,
    "drumir": 801,
}

Subject: Partner SFTP drop — new owner

Hi,

As you review the pending changes to the Harborline ingest scripts, note that ownership of the partner SFTP drop is changing at the end of the month. This includes key rotation, the nightly pull job, and the quarantine folder for malformed files. Review comments on the retry logic should still go through the normal PR flow, but questions about drop-folder conventions or partner onboarding now go to the new owner. The incoming owner is listed below.

signatory, tagaf-bahaf: Praael Fenmir Rusok

CI troubleshooting — spreadsheet export memory

For the release manager: the Gartleby export worker was ballooning past 6 GB on large workbook jobs because the XLSX writer buffered every sheet in memory before flushing. We switched to streaming row writes in the candidate build, which caps usage near 800 MB on the same fixtures. Canary ran overnight with no OOM kills. Recommend including this in the Thursday cut. The candidate build token is below.

build token for yajof-bajof: htk31_506ff1188f74596b5bb2eec94edc43c

TURN-208: Gatevale turnstile counters at the Merrow Field pilot double-count when a rotation reverses mid-cycle. Attendance totals drift roughly 2% high per event. The debounce window fix is implemented, reviewed by Ilsa, and soak-tested across two simulated match days without drift. Ready for your cut; the candidate build is identified below.

trace token, tagag-tafog: htk6_5ed18c